Kosovo MPs, who asked abolition of Specialist Chambers, put in visa-ban blacklist

Members of Parliament who signed the initiative to abrogate the Law on Kosovo Specialist Chambers and Specialist Prosecution Office are put on the visa-ban blacklist by friendly countries of Kosovo, Gazeta Express has learned from diplomatic sources.

Traffic resumes in Llogara Tunnel after accident

Traffic has resumed in the Llogara Tunnel after a temporary closure caused by a collision between two vehicles. The Albanian Road Authority said police, ambulance, and firefighters arrived quickly and managed the situation. Authorities reopened the tunnel shortly after clearing the scene.
